The Institute originated from the Singapore Institute of Engineering Technicians founded in 1980 to cater for the interests of Polytechnic and VITB (now ITE) engineering graduates. Its name was changed to the Singapore Institute of Engineering Technologists in 1986.
SIET is governed by an elected Executive Council and supported by four working committees: Membership & Qualifications; Education & Training; Publications ; Social Functions and the SIET – Accreditation Board.
